| Smith's sign |
a murmur heard in cases of enlarged bronchial glands on auscultation over the manubrium with the patient's head thrown back.

| smile |
Colloquialism for a lacerated golf ball; a cut in the ball is normally caused by a thinned shot.

| smile |
The term commonly used to describe the fact that the implied volatilities of out-of-the-money options are normally higher than those of at the money options.
